> On Thu, Oct 5, 2017 at 3:16 PM, Bin Cheng <[email protected]> wrote:
>> Hi,
>> Function rename_variables_in_bb skips renaming PHI nodes in loop nest if the
>> outer loop has only one inner loop. This breaks loop nest distribution when
>> inner loop has PHI node initialized from outer loop's variable.
>> Unfortunately,
>> I lost the original C code illustrating the issue. Now it is only triggered
>> in building spec2006/416.gamess with loop nest distribution, but I failed to
>> reduce a test from it.

2017-10-10 Bin Cheng <[email protected]>
* tree-vect-loop-manip.c (rename_variables_in_bb): Rename PHI nodes
when copying loop nest with only one inner loop.
2017-10-10 Bin Cheng <[email protected]>
* gcc.dg/tree-ssa/ldist-34.c: New test.
